The article analyses the dynamics of development of civil legislation in terms of regulation of real estate issues. The author comes to the conclusion that under the influence of public law legislation, reasonable changes were made to the Civil Code of the Russian Federation, while the concept of a real estate has not changed for thirty years, and this, in the author’s opinion, is also justified. In general, the author comes to the conclusion that despite diametrically opposed goals, in real estate matters, civil and public legislation coexist quite harmoniously.
Translated title of the contributionThe Civil Code of the Russian Federation and Real Estate: Does the Civil Code Need Updating?
